Nonprofit brings ‘serenity rooms’ to teachers at 5 schools in Buncombe County

BUNCOMBE COUNTY, N.C. (WLOS) — Five schools in Buncombe County have received relaxing “serenity rooms” for teachers, designed and installed by local nonprofit, The Christos Foundation.

The organization’s goal is to provide teachers with a cozy space to take a break from the classroom.
